Toilet repair services involve diagnosing and fixing a variety of common issues that can disrupt the function of a toilet. These services typically include repairing or replacing faulty flappers, fill valves, flush mechanisms, and seals. When a toilet runs constantly, leaks at the base, or won’t flush properly, professional repair can restore proper operation. Properly functioning toilets are essential for daily hygiene and convenience, making timely repairs important to prevent further damage or water waste.
Many toilet problems are caused by wear and tear over time, mineral buildup, or accidental damage. Common issues such as constant running, weak flushing power, or frequent clogs can often be resolved through targeted repairs. In some cases, parts may need replacement, or the entire unit might require upgrading to more efficient models. The overview below groups typical Toilet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Most routine toilet repairs, such as fixing a running toilet or replacing a flapper, typically cost between $150 and $300. These projects are common and usually fall within the lower to middle end of the price range. Local contractors often handle these quick fixes efficiently within this budget.
Toilet Replacement - Replacing an old or broken toilet with a new model generally ranges from $350 to $800. Many standard installations fall into this range, while more complex setups or premium fixtures can push costs higher. Larger projects may reach around $1,000 or more depending on the scope.
Major Repairs - Extensive repairs, such as fixing leaks in the plumbing or addressing foundational issues, can cost between $1,000 and $3,000. These jobs are less frequent and tend to involve more labor and parts, leading to higher prices. Many projects stay within the lower to middle part of this range.
Full Bathroom Overhaul - Complete bathroom renovations involving toilet replacement, plumbing upgrades, and fixture installations can range from $5,000 to $15,000 or more. These larger projects are less common and typically involve multiple service providers working over an extended period.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
